How do i upgrade xc8 compiler from free version to pro with. Use and implications of evalexpression in matlab code. Follow guidelines and practices for authoring matlab apps to be secure web apps. If you use products that require one, apples development environment for os x. When it comes to discussing the creating calculations, dissecting information, and making modules. Learn more about matlab compiler matlab, matlab compiler. Once you pick the main file, matlab compiler automatically recognizes some file dependencies, like matlab functions being used in the main program, and the fig file needed for the user interface. Matlab combines a desktop environment tuned for iterative analysis and design processes with a programming language that expresses matrix and array mathematics directly.
The slowdown occurs because matlab uses a jit compiler, and eval lines cannot be optimized. With matlab compiler you can also package and deploy matlab programs as mapreduce and spark big data applications and as microsoft excel addins. During the prerelease period, these bug reports are not updated with information on potential fixes. The actual developer of the free software is the mathworks, inc. The toolchain iar embedded workbench gives you a complete ide with everything you need in one single view ensuring quality, reliability and efficiency in your embedded application. Julia includes a repl read eval print loop, or interactive command line, similar to what python offers. Mathworks matlab r2020a crack also useful for machine learning, signal processing, and robotics.
I have installed 64bit matlab on my pc windows 7, 64bit and am trying to install a c compiler. Filefixation download full version software games movies tv. Also, it lies in educational tools, and it is more precisely science tools. Unpack the zip file and from the created folder call the program installtl. This is the stunning app to download from our software library. Matlab torrent is the product created by mathworks. Quick oneoff scripts and commands can be punched right in. Computing in operations research using julia arxiv. Matlab is a programming language developed by mathworks. To turn your acquired data into real business results, you can develop algorithms for data analysis and advanced control with included math and signal processing ip or reuse your own libraries from a.
Matlab compiler sdk includes a development version of matlab production. Iar embedded workbench is by many considered the best compiler and debugger toolchain in the industry. Matlab torrent is the worlds most popular and powerful graphics software that it is mainly used by scientists and engineers. Matlab r2020b crack torrent with full version latest. Pspice is a complete simulator that allows you to analyze the behavior of an electric circuit board. Installation of the microsoft windows sdk for windows 7 product has reported the following error. Download mex compilers matlab answers matlab central. Matlab r2016b full torrent click to download full softs. For each version are two ccs images that can be downloaded, dvd image and microcontroller core.
The following known software and documentation bugs are currently considered resolved in the prerelease. Ccstudio code composer studio ccs integrated development. Aug 11, 2015 to demonstrate creating and executing a python program, well make a simple hello world program. The example codes are developed, compiled, and tested in matlab 2009b and matlab compiler 4. Matlab compiler lets you share matlab programs as standalone, mapreduce, and spark applications. If only a directory name is included with the a option, the entire contents of that directory are.
I am using matlab for the optimization, hypermesh as a preprocessor for my model and abaqus as my fea solver. Matlab compiler runtime is an engine that includes the same shared libraries that matlab uses to allow the execution of scripts, making them. Certain matlab features, particularly the eval function, can increase the risk of injection attacks. Matlab production server requires a matlab runtime instance to execute the deployed matlab applications that it hosts. Go to the location where you downloaded the installer. Add files to the deployable archive using a path to specify the files to be added. Enter this code into nano, then press ctrlx and y to exit and save the file. Code composer studio comprises a suite of tools used to develop and debug embedded applications. Matlab compiler runtime free download windows version. That should be enough if you just want to use matlab function block in a simulink model for simulation. Functions not supported for compilation by matlab compiler. In most cases, using the eval function is less efficient than using other matlab functions.
Accept all defaults and leave your computer alone for the next couple of hours depending on your internet connection. After finishing the installation, all programs can then be started directly from command line. Once gnumex is in the matlab path run gnumex in matlab. Recommended for inline advanced mathematics and signal processing. Eval during compile gnu emacs lisp reference manual. Matlab r2016b is a software package for solving technical computing and eponymous programming language used in this package. This is a rare and serious limitation compared with other mainstream programming language or developing environment. C compiler for matlab in 64bit windows matlab answers. Licensing activehdl student edition includes a load and go license. It spawns a subshell to do matlab and, when done, moves the results back to a main directory. Matlab compiles code the first time you run it to enhance performance for future runs. However, because code in an eval statement can change at run time, it is not compiled code within an eval statement can unexpectedly create or assign to a variable already in the current workspace, overwriting existing data concatenated character vectors within an eval statement are often difficult to. When matlab code is executed this way it does not require license and thus large amounts of c converted matlab codes. Activehdl student edition fpga simulation products aldec.
Matlab is used more than one million engineers and scientists, it works on most modern operating systems, including linux, mac os, solaris mathworks matlab r2016b full 64bit simulation with mathworks matlab r2016b. Analyze data, develop algorithms, and create mathematical models. Our downloads database is updated daily to provide the latest download releases on offer. There are many things that have to be taken into account, like the fact that circuit boards can vary in kind, from analog to.
Download pspice free and try its functions and methods. Compile matlab functions for deployment matlab mcc. To begin, open the nano text editor and create a new file named helloworld. Drag your matlab runtime installation folder to the trash, and then select empty trash from the finder menu. Onmaintenance licenses issued on or after december 7, 2018 will be in the new trl file format. To develop using an mspexp430g2 launchpad kit visit ti resource. This compiler and its license is supported only by equipment using 32bit operating systems. For new development, visit the mspexp430g2et launchpad kit, which has replaced the mspexp430g2 kit.
The solidworks online product trial offers you the latest product release and access to solidworks simulation, solidworks mbd. Cadence pspice technology combines industryleading, native analog, mixedsignal, and analysis engines to deliver a complete circuit simulation and verification solution. For more details on the license key file format change, click here. However, the prerelease is not a fully qualified release, and some of these resolutions have not yet been verified. It is similar to commercial systems such as matlab from mathworks, and idl from research systems, but is open source. Using eval here will certainly be slower than a noneval version, but most likely it wont be a bottleneck in you code. Matlab compiler runtime runs on the following operating systems. The number of rows in y is equal to the number of solution components being returned for multipoint boundary value problems, the solution obtained by bvp4c or bvp5c might be discontinuous at the interfaces. Octave online is a web ui for gnu octave, the opensource alternative to matlab.
How do i upgrade xc8 compiler from free version to pro with omniscient code generation 20150510 03. May 24, 2017 matlab matrix laboratory is a multiparadigm numerical computing environment and fourthgeneration programming language which is frequently being used by engineering and science students. Many python programmers report substantial productivity. To run standalone applications, install the matlab runtime. Thus for a student or a hobby user, it is very hard to share the developed program with others who do not have matlab.
Download rti connext dds professional free trial rti. For compilers and licenses that are compatible with 64bit operating systems, see our mplab xc c compiler products. The point is to provide an application in which other developpers could add their plugins, written in matlab. This executable can be used in fgi when the matlab compiler runtime mcr is available. Download current and previous versions of the keil development tools. Whats new in the latest release of matlab and simulink. Matlab crack is the best device that can satisfy your needs. It includes the live editor for creating scripts that combine code, output, and formatted text in an executable notebook. Type commands in the prompt like you would in your local copy of gnu octave or matlab. Download example projects and various utilities which enable you to extend the capabilities of.
Mplab ecosystem downloads archive microchip technology. Matlab compiler is only available in professional and academic version with a very high price. End users can run your applications royaltyfree using matlab runtime to provide browserbased access to your matlab web apps. Matlab torrent can also directly create a cuda code through combined deployment. The pspice user community is your destination to find pspice resources, ask and answer questions, and interact with your industry peers and pspice experts. If you load the source file, rather than compiling it, body is evaluated normally. These applications use the matlab runtime, a set of shared libraries that enables the execution of compiled applications and components. The next for loop creates a run directory for matlab, so individual matlab instances dont clash. It uses the tiny c compiler as the compiler backend and has full support for the mal language, including macros, tailcall elimination, and even runtime eval.
Quick and easy way to compile and run programs online. Before you can integrate matlab functions into external applications, you need to package them for the target language. When i installed it, it said that i could upgrade to pro mode for 60 days. There is a new version of msp430g2 launchpad kit the mspexp430g2et that includes improved energytrace measurements and onboard emulation for programming and debuggingg. This compiler and its license is supported only by 32bit operating systems. Labview enables you to immediately visualize results with builtin, draganddrop engineering user interface creation and integrated data viewers. Multiple a options are permitted if a file name is specified with a, the compiler looks for these files on the matlab path, so specifying the full path name is optional. End users can run your applications royaltyfree using matlab runtime. It started out as a matrix programming language where linear algebra programming was simple. The apps guide you in specifying functions to package and in creating an installer. The independent desktop and web applications in matlab compiler, share your apps. Freemat is a free environment for rapid engineering and scientific prototyping and data processing.
Matlab2018b is the latest and powerful software for easy and efficient app. For compilers and licenses that are compatible with equipment using 64bit operating systems, see our mplab xc c compiler products. How do i upgrade xc8 compiler from free version to pro. We will use macros as a basis for both linear and nonlinear modeling. The design of any circuit board requires very specific software. This form marks body to be evaluated at compile time but not when the compiled program is loaded.
Code composer studio is an integrated development environment ide that supports tis microcontroller and embedded processors portfolio. I thought if you dont have any c compiler, the default lcc will be used. Andreas goser on 12 aug 2014 since the matlab compiler library is not available for the student license how might i compile a matlab gui to a. If you have a constant that needs some calculation to produce, eval when. Matlab compiler runtime is categorized as development tools. Matlab compiler documentation mathworks united kingdom. Matlab compiler runtime is an engine that includes the same shared libraries that matlab uses to allow the execution of scripts, making them compatible with any pc they are launched on.
Functions and other reference release notes pdf documentation. Compiled matlab is generally not going to be faster, but it. The latest link will always be at the top but you can use the other links to download specific versions. If i were to purchase the library would it even run on.
Learn more about matlab 2015a, mex compiler, windows 10. Code that calls eval is often less efficient and more difficult to read and debug than code that uses other functions or language constructs. Matlab compiler looks for these files on the matlab path, so specifying the full pathname is optional. Includes device drivers for ni hardware and thirdparty instruments. These components can be integrated with custom applications and then deployed to desktop, web, and enterprise systems.
Thousands of students, educators, and researchers from around the world use octave online each day for studying machine learning, control systems, numerical methods, and more. Mac os x on the mac, no c compiler is supplied with matlab. However, the performance is only one issue, maintenance incl. Fortran compilers are supported with simulink only for creating simulink sfunctions using the matlab mex command. It helps you to import, cleaning, filtering, and sort your data. The sfunctions can be used with normal and accelerated simulations. A common countermeasure is input sanitization or input. When you start matlab using nodisplay unix or nofigurewindows microsoft windows startup options, running a builtin gui predefined dialog boxes generates this warning. How to write and run a python program on the raspberry pi. Applications created for web deployment and access must not contain calls to eval.
The common filename for the programs installer is matlab. Trl keys have a new crypto field starting with sign. Matlab compiler enables you to share matlab programs as standalone applications and web apps. Depending on your windows security settings, you may get a window asking if you are sure you want to run this program. The result of evaluation by the compiler becomes a constant which appears in the compiled program. Matlab compiler runtime is a shareware software in the category development developed by the mathworks, inc the latest version of matlab compiler runtime is currently unknown. The examples are working on scalars, vectors, and matrixes which are inputsoutputs of functions for every application. I can add some user specific data through a mat file, which is essentially a basic matlab file type used to store matlab variables and objects. Choose a web site to get translated content where available and see local events and offers. Online octave compiler online octave editor online. Python is a dynamic objectoriented programming language that can be used for many kinds of software development. Keil downloads include software products and updates, example programs and various utilities you may use to learn about or extend the capabilities of your keil development tools. In the window appearing, enter the path to your mingw.
Supported compiler changes mathworks refreshes its compiler support every release, occasionally dropping support for an older version of a compiler in favor of a newer and more readily available version. This functionality is no longer supported under the nodisplay and nofigurewindows startup options. Compiler for r2012b on windows 8 matlab answers matlab. The mplab c compiler for pic18 mcus also known as mplab c18 is a fullfeatured ansi compliant c compiler for the pic18 family of picmicro 8bit mcus. The 3dexperience works for startups program offers software, training, and comarketing resources at no cost to help you succeed. Run simulations, generate code, and test and verify embedded systems. However, many matlab codes can be translated to c coded executables.
Online octave compiler, online octave editor, online octave ide, octave coding online, practice octave online, execute octave online, compile octave online, run octave online, online octave interpreter, execute matlaboctave online gnu octave, v4. Activehdl student edition is a mixed language design entry and simulation tool offered at no cost by aldec for students to use during their course work. For an interface point xc, the deval function returns the average of the limits from the left and right of xc. Mex doesnt work on windows 10, 64bit matlab answers. Do any of you know of a way to reverse this encryption and get readable matlab code again. Interpolated solution, returned as a vector or matrix. It offers you one month of free trial with full functionality. Download the installer appropriate to your operating system. These files are not passed to mbuild, so you can include files such as data files if a folder name is specified with the a option. Pragma to help matlab compiler locate functions called through.
Matlab compiler sdk includes two apps and a commandline compiler for this purpose. I have installed xc8 under mplabx and i have rapidly filled up the device. If you plan to redistribute your mexfiles to other matlab users, be sure that they have the runtime libraries. These files are not passed to mbuild, so you can include files such as data files. It was initially added to our database on 07222012.
563 430 9 147 1553 504 1460 401 3 1087 1626 1543 313 774 259 919 710 1552 993 1413 1125 417 1488 8 14 184 1283 1391 551 678